Sub : UGC Regulations on minimum qualifications for appointment and Career Advancement of
Lecturers, Readers and Professors in the Universities and Colleges.
Dear Sir/Madam,
In supersession of UGC Regulation No.F.1-11/87 (CPP-11) dated 19th September, 1991 and
Notification No. F.3-l/94 (PS) dated 24 December, 1998, the UGC had made the Regulations
th
for minimum qualifications required for the appointment and career advancement of teachers in
universities and institutions affiliated to it.
The Regulations have been sent to Assistant Controller (Commercial), Government of India,
Department of Publication, (Urban Development and Employment) Civil Lines, Delhi, for
publication in the Gazette of India.
The provision contained in the UGC Notification of 24üi December, 1998 mentioning that it would
be optional for the university to exempt Ph. D. degree holders from NET or to require NET in their
case as a desirable or essential qualification for appointment as lecturer has been withdrawn. NET
shall remain the compulsory requirement for appointment as Lecturer even for candidates having
Ph. D. degree. However, the candidates who have completed M.Phil. degree or have submitted Ph.
D. thesis in the concerned subject up to 3 1 st December, 1993, are exempted from appearing in
the NET examination.
The proviso in the Regulation, 1991 which reads as follows :-
Provided that any relaxation in the prescribed qualifications can only be made by a University in
regard to the posts under it or any of the institutions including constituent or affiliated colleges
recognised under clause C) of Section 2 of the aforesaid Act or by an institution deemed to be
a university under Section 3 of the said Act with the prior approval of the University Grants
Commission.
has been dropped and is replaced by the following proviso :-
Provided that any relaxation in the prescribed qualifications can only be made by the University
Grants Commission in a particular subject in which NET is not being conducted or enough
number of candidates are not available with NET qualifications for a specified period only. (this
relaxation, if allowed, would be given based on sound justification and would apply to affected
Universities for that particular subject for the specified period. No individual applications would
be entertained.)
The Regulations issued by the UGC are mandatory in nature and all the universities are advised
to strictly comply with them. It shall be necessary for the universities and the management of
colleges to make the necessary changes in their statutes, ordinances, rules, regulations, etc. to
incorporate these Regulations.
